What safety precautions should I observe when handling these strong magnets?
The magnetic frame’s strong hold demands care during use. Keep fingers away from the snap zone when joining both hoop parts. It’s safer to slide the upper ring off sideways rather than pulling it straight. Also, avoid placing the hoop near pacemakers, sensitive cards, or electronic devices, as magnetic fields may interfere with certain electronics and medical equipment.
What should I do if the magnetic frame seems to shift slightly during dense embroidery designs?
This issue is uncommon with MaggieFrame magnetic hoops, but if it occurs, first ensure that the brackets on your Doublelin machine are tightly secured. Next, confirm that an appropriate stabilizer is used beneath the fabric. For slippery materials, adding a thin non‑slip layer can increase grip. These steps help maintain embroidery alignment even on high‑stitch‑count patterns.
